Highfield Barn
Highfield Barn is a farm in Waddington, North Kesteven, England. Highfield Barn is situated nearby to East Mere Irrigation Reservoir, as well as near the forest Dunston Pillar Wood.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dunston Pillar
Building
Photo: Nickfraser,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Dunston Pillar is a Grade II listed stone tower in Lincolnshire, England and a former 'land lighthouse'. It stands beside the A15 road approximately 6 miles south of Lincoln near the junction of the B1178, in the parish of Dunston, north of Sleaford. Dunston Pillar is situated 1 mile south of Highfield Barn.

Bracebridge
Town
Photo: Richard Croft,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Bracebridge is a suburb of Lincoln, Lincolnshire, England. It is situated approximately 2 miles south from the city centre on the main A1434 Newark Road, stretching approximately from St Catherine's to Swallowbeck alongside the east bank of the River Witham, and the village of Bracebridge Heath. Bracebridge is situated 4 miles northwest of Highfield Barn.
